Obter novos eventos de migração de comércio
Aplica-se a: Partner Center | Partner Center operado pela 21Vianet | Partner Center for Microsoft Cloud for US Government
Como obter detalhes de eventos de migração com base na ID de assinatura atual ou na ID de migração
Pré-requisitos
- Credenciais conforme descrito na autenticação do Partner Center. Este cenário oferece suporte à autenticação com credenciais autônomas de Aplicativo e Aplicativo+Usuário.
Essa API pode obter eventos de migração com base em cadeias de caracteres de consulta selecionadas pelo parceiro. As cadeias de caracteres de consulta selecionadas podem incluir as seguintes opções:
Um CustomerTenantId. Se não souber o ID do cliente, pode procurá-lo no Partner Center selecionando a área de trabalho Clientes e, em seguida, o cliente na lista de clientes e, em seguida, Conta. Na página Conta do cliente, procure a ID da Microsoft na seção Informações da Conta do Cliente. A ID da Microsoft é a mesma que a ID do cliente.
Um CurrentSubscriptionId (a ID herdada de uma assinatura que foi migrada)
Um MigrationId (a ID do objeto de migração associado à assinatura atual)
Pedido REST
Sintaxe da solicitação
Método | URI do pedido |
---|---|
GET | {baseURL}/v1/customers/{customer-tenant-id}/migrations/newcommerce/events HTTP/1.1 |
Cadeias de Consulta
Esta tabela lista as cadeias de caracteres de consulta que podem ser usadas para recuperar novos eventos de migração de comércio. Pelo menos uma das duas IDs é necessária para recuperar com êxito os eventos de migração associados a uma assinatura atual. A introdução do ID de migração e do ID de subscrição atual é aceite, mas não é necessária.
Nome | Descrição |
---|---|
MigrationId | Uma cadeia de caracteres formatada em GUID que identifica o objeto de migração. |
CurrentSubscriptionId | Uma cadeia de caracteres formatada em GUID que identifica uma assinatura herdada migrada. |
Cabeçalhos do pedido
Para obter mais informações, consulte Cabeçalhos REST do Partner Center.
Corpo do pedido
Nenhum.
Resposta do REST
Se for bem-sucedido, esse método retornará detalhes do evento da Assinatura atual que foi migrada no corpo da resposta.
Códigos de sucesso e erro de resposta
Cada resposta vem com um código de status HTTP que indica sucesso ou falha e outras informações de depuração. Use uma ferramenta de rastreamento de rede para ler esse código, tipo de erro e outros parâmetros. Para obter a lista completa, consulte Códigos de erro REST do Partner Center.
Exemplos de URL de solicitação
baseurl/v1/customers/aaaabbbb-0000-cccc-1111-dddd2222eeee/migrations/newcommerce/events?current_subscription_id=02DF825B-D0C9-40BE-8CB6-BAC895510D0A
Exemplos de respostas
[
{
"id": "6eb07675-ba1d-45c2-9d05-c693a4863427",
"newCommerceMigrationId": "e4c1c037-7c4c-42bd-bb41-dae2aa29ebcc",
"currentSubscriptionId": "02df825b-d0c9-40be-8cb6-bac895510d0a",
"customerTenantId": "aaaabbbb-0000-cccc-1111-dddd2222eeee",
"createdTime": "2022-06-11T00:06:02.7529574Z",
"eventName": "MigrationStarted"
},
{
"id": "e828079b-c974-4822-977e-f12ac67380db",
"newCommerceMigrationId": "e4c1c037-7c4c-42bd-bb41-dae2aa29ebcc",
"currentSubscriptionId": "02df825b-d0c9-40be-8cb6-bac895510d0a",
"customerTenantId": "aaaabbbb-0000-cccc-1111-dddd2222eeee",
"createdTime": "2022-06-11T00:06:21.526778Z",
"eventName": "NewCommerceSubscriptionCreated"
},
{
"id": "7dbdcbd5-7a87-4d9b-bf1f-d9298493e631",
"newCommerceMigrationId": "e4c1c037-7c4c-42bd-bb41-dae2aa29ebcc",
"currentSubscriptionId": "02df825b-d0c9-40be-8cb6-bac895510d0a",
"customerTenantId": "aaaabbbb-0000-cccc-1111-dddd2222eeee",
"createdTime": "2022-06-11T00:08:08.5185085Z",
"eventName": "NewCommerceSubscriptionProvisioned"
},
{
"id": "71a3f753-55ca-461e-807d-f541685d5c8b",
"newCommerceMigrationId": "e4c1c037-7c4c-42bd-bb41-dae2aa29ebcc",
"currentSubscriptionId": "02df825b-d0c9-40be-8cb6-bac895510d0a",
"customerTenantId": "aaaabbbb-0000-cccc-1111-dddd2222eeee",
"createdTime": "2022-06-11T00:10:07.6947014Z",
"eventName": "MigrationCompleted"
}
]